    You can use paint stripper as long as you protect your floor with a tarp and some tape and keep a window open to avoid breathing in the fumes too much. Apply the paint stripper, allow it to act, and scrape it off. If some paint didn't come off, apply more paint stripper. When you're done, wash off the paint stripper residue with water and sodium carbonate (or just dish soap). If you have concerns about the paint stripper damaging the baseboards, test it out in a place that's not very visible first. You can also use a hot air gun but only if your baseboards are made out of wood (or they'll melt) but be careful not to burn your baseboards. Warm the paint with the hot air gun until it starts to form bubbles on the surface, then just scrape the paint off with a scraper. Just keep in mind that it's much easier to damage the wood using this technique (also, you might burn yourself) so go at it gently. If you're feeling brave (or hate your back) you can try sanding.

    Mostly good advice, but NEVER store your wet paintbrush upright to dry! The water sinks to the bottom and either warps the brush or messes up the adhesive and you lose chunks of bristles. Lay flat or even better reshape and hang from the handle to dry

    Advice: do not patch the holes that way. You can clearly see that the patch shrunk down and the hole is still noticeable. Filling takes about 2-3 coats depending on the size, with sanding in between to make it flush with the walls.

One tip: If your like me and not single, you may get interrupted by kids, hubs, errands, chores. In your paint tray and handheld paint bucket, you can use the liners she mentioned, they sell both at the store. But you can also use plastic bags for both! For the paint tray I use about 6gal trash bags with open edge towards the deeper end then tape closed. For the hand bucket I use bread loaf bags ( can be found in food storage bag area of some stores) or other similar small bags. Then when you are interrupted, simply cover the tray with another bag and tape or tie closed, and tie closed the bag in hand bucket with itself or a rubber band, making sure no holes are open. When you are ready to paint the next time, your paint is readily available with no crusty, dry crumbs that can ruin a paint job.

    I don't remember her saying anything about ventilation, so here are a few tips from my experience. If it's a bedroom you are painting, please consider the season you are in and if you should be painting during that time. Plan to sleep in another room of the house until your project is completely finished. I made the mistake of painting during a really cold winter and I had to open the windows to let fresh air in. Low odor cans of paint can help with the smell, but nevertheless they still do strongly smell if you are covering large areas. Cheap respirator masks can only protect you from breathing sanding and other particles, temporarily. Invest in a face mask that can protect you from those particles and possibly the smell too, if its too strong. You can try covering your mouth and nose with a shirt around your neck, but I don't know how effective that would be in blocking out the smell of paint. Hope this helps.
